Mill Street Park is a charming community hub located in London, Kentucky, perfect for families and their four-legged friends. Known for its inviting atmosphere and extensive play equipment, this park offers an ideal spot for locals looking for a dog-friendly park with plenty of green space and activities for all ages. Easy access, clean grounds, and amenities like a splash pad, volleyball court, and covered picnic areas make it stand out among dog parks in London, KY.
This pet-friendly park is particularly praised by families for its variety of play opportunities, shaded seating areas, and convenient covered shelters, making it comfortable for both dogs and owners. While primarily a family park, responsible dog owners enjoy walking their pets here before or after using the play facilities. Whether you’re searching for a peaceful afternoon stroll or a place to relax while your children play, Mill Street Park offers a welcoming environment for both people and pups!

Stopped here on the way home to give the kids somewhere to play while we ate lunch. Cute little park, lots of slide and swing options (the two things my kiddos care about). Overall everything needed a little maintenance (mowing, paint touch up, lots of rubber mulch in volleyball court), but it was still a nice place to play. Bathrooms were porta-potties, but they worked just fine.
